97/511/EC: Council Decision of 24 July 1997 authorizing the Federal Republic of Germany to conclude with the Czech Republic an Agreement containing measures derogating from Articles 2 and 3 of the Sixth Directive (77/388/EEC) on the harmonization of the laws of the Member States relating to turnover taxes

Article 1

The Federal Republic of Germany is hereby authorized to conclude an agreement with the Czech Republic concerning the construction of a frontier bridge in the Spitzberg area, which partly is on the territory of the Federal Republic of Germany and partly on the territory of the Czech Republic, linking the German A17 motorway heading east with the Czech D8 motorway heading west, containing measures derogating from Directive 77/388/EEC.

The derogations provided for by this agreement are spelt out in Articles 2 and 3 of this Decision.

Article 2

By way of derogation from Article 3 of the Sixth Directive, insofar as they extend onto the sovereign territory of the Federal Republic of Germany, the area of the construction site for the frontier bridge referred to in Article 1 of this Decision and, after its completion, the frontier bridge itself shall be treated as forming part of the sovereign territory of the Czech Republic as regards supplies of goods or services intended for the construction of the frontier bridge or for its repair and renewal.

Article 3

By way of derogation from Article 2 (2) of the Sixth Directive, the information of goods into Germany from the Czech Republic shall not be subject to value added tax insofar as those goods are used for the construction and the maintenance of the bridge referred to in Article 1 of this Decision. However, this derogation shall not apply to goods imported for the same purpose by a public authority.

Article 4

This Decision is addressed to the Federal Republic of Germany.
